Ravens vs. Panthers Free Pick
After losing in Atlanta last Thursday, the Baltimore Ravens look to regroup against a hapless Carolina Panthers team this Sunday. Continue reading for our Week 11 free pick on this game.
According to latest NFL Odds, oddsmakers from online sports book Sportsbook.com have made the Ravens 10-point favorites over the Panthers in Week 11. The over/under total for this game is currently 37 points.
The Ravens enter Sunday’s game with a 6-3 record but they’re just 4-4-1 against the spread according to latest NFL trends. They’re just 2-3 on the road this year and just 2-2-1 against the spread away from home.
After losing to the Bucs last Sunday, the Panthers fell to 1-8 over this season and are now just 2-7 against the spread. They’re 1-4 at home this season and have failed to cover in four of their five games at Bank of America Stadium.
Our Week 11 NFL Free Pick:
John Fox’s decision to start Brian St. Pierre over rookie Tony Pike in the middle of a youth movement was befuddling to say the least. It’s no wonder why Fox will be looking for another job next year when his contract expires. That said, it’s tough for teams to cover double-digit point spreads when they’re at home – nevertheless on the road, which is where the Ravens will be this Sunday. Baltimore should be well-rested after playing last Thursday night and Joe Flacco should have no problems moving the ball on Carolina’s suspect defense. But call this a hunch – we think the Panthers cover. The Ravens are 0-4 against the spread versus a team with a losing record and if you wait closer to kickoff you may get a great line on Carolina. Our pick is the Panthers minus the points.
2010 NFL WEEK 11 FREE PICK: CAROLINA PANTHERS +10.5
